Transaction 566c10803377db98a832a7eeb1353cac7a2cf000aae65e4a233edc10a15a6f1b
1 Input
1 Output
-
566c10803377db98a832a7eeb1353cac7a2cf000aae65e4a233edc10a15a6f1b:0
- value
- 40189062
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3be15e0e58137ced5fdba4296f9660f756d080a2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16Tcr7xNFaK1WVDSSxGVLhFDAFCEzZ616Z